Featured speakers

Phyllis Lee
VP,Content Development, CIS

Phyllis Lee is the Vice President of Content Development at the Center for Internet Security. (CIS). She has over 25 years of experience in information assurance and has performed vulnerability assessments, virtualization research and worked in security automation. Prior to joining CIS, Lee worked at the National Security Agency (NSA) focusing on the intersection between malware and virtualization, which included collaboration with MIT Lincoln Labs. Lee also participated in a variety of security automation standardization efforts and led the security automation strategy for the NSA Information Assurance Directorate (IAD). She graduated from Johns Hopkins University with a Master of Science in Computer Science.

Brian Hubbard
Founder & President, MSPCyberX​

Brian Hubbard is a Lead Certified CMMC Assessor, CMMC Instructor, and President of Evolved Cyber. With over 40 years of experience, he has helped dozens of defense contractors and service providers build audit-ready cybersecurity programs aligned with CMMC and NIST SP 800-171. Brian also founded MSPCyberX, a nonprofit supporting MSPs navigating compliance in the Defense Industrial Base. A contributor to the original NIST Cybersecurity Framework, he brings a deep understanding of both technical implementation and assessor expectations. Brian regularly leads workshops, internal training, and peer groups focused on practical, cost-effective strategies for CMMC readiness and first-pass assessment success.
